OnEscapee game problem

I have the iso of onEscapee for A1200, I have tried to use it of equal way that a Iso of CD32 using Alcohol 120 virtual unit but does not load the game and I only see the startscreen of kickstart or nothing in the WB.

Well, ClassicWB is AmigaOS (or you'd rather say that it uses AmigaOS since it's a preinstalled Workbench environment). I'm quite sure thatI've played onEscapee through ClassicWB... Try launching ClassicWB and add the Alcohol virtual drive (or the real CD/DVD-ROM drive if you've burnt the disc) as a harddrive (through a Windows folder, not hard disk image obviously) if it doesn't appear by itself. You should then be able to run the game!

My pleasure Actually, I use this method all the time when CDs won't show up in WinUAE. It never fails. But sometimes you will have to remember to give the fake harddrive the same name as the CD or the game will not work (forgot to point that out). And it will not always work with CD32/CDTV games either since they use a trademark file.
